Wednesday Night Book Discussion
Join us at the Gates Mills Branch Library as we discuss *Breakfast at Tiffany’s* by Truman Capote. You've seen the movie but have you read the book?! Holly Golightly, former starlet and cafe society item, floats through life, looking for where she belongs. Ms. Golightly is and will remain one of the most original and intriguing characters in American fiction. The novel has a harder edge and is more revealing about human nature than the movie. Read it and you'll appreciate Audrey Hepburn's portrayal all the more. Everyone is welcomed to attend the discussion. Call the branch library for more information (440-423-4808).
